What should I expect during a first tutoring session in Elkview, WV?
A first tutoring session in Elkview, WV often focuses on understanding the student’s current skill level, learning style, and academic goals. Tutors may review past assignments, identify areas for improvement, and create a plan for future sessions. Does tutoring count as child care in Elkview, WV?
Tutoring in Elkview, WV is generally focused on academic support rather than traditional child care, but some tutors may provide supervision during sessions. The primary goal of tutoring is to help students improve in specific subjects or skills. Understanding whether tutoring counts as child care can help families choose the right type of support.
